Hitting Blinkers: A Guide for Modern Motorists
In today's hustling driving environment, it's more important than ever to communicate your intentions clearly to other drivers. hitting blinkers disposable Properly using your blinkers is a fundamental skill that can help prevent accidents and guarantee a smoother flow of traffic. Here are some recommendations for activating your blinkers correctly.
- Regularly check your surroundings before changing lanes or merging.
- Indicator your intentions well in time - at least 100 feet ahead of the maneuver.
- Maintain your blinker lights are working correctly.
- Cancel your blinkers as soon as you have achieved the lane change or maneuver.
- Be consistent in your use of blinkers to improve driver awareness and safety on the road.

Flashing Fiasco: When Your Signal's Out of Whack
Is your automobile sporting a signal light that's more erratic? A faint signal can frustrate other road users, increasing everyone at danger. Don't let a malfunctioning blinker result in trouble.
There are a few factors why your signals might be on the fritz.
* Occasionally, it's as easy as a burned-out bulb.
* Other times, there could be a problem with the circuitry.
No matter of the reason, it's important to get your blinkers serviced promptly. A few simple checks can aid you identify the problem.
